If you currently have Gold, Platinum, or Diamond Delta status you will be able to receive elite status in the Hertz Gold Plus Rewards program! While many might not care about car rental status, you can get some pretty good perks when having status with Hertz.

  • Diamond Medallions will receive President’s Circle® status
  • Platinum Medallions will receive President’s Circle® status
  • Gold Medallions will receive Five Star® status

Hertz Status with Delta

To receive this status you will need to enter your Delta Skymiles number on this Delta site. No where on the site does it ask you to enter your Hertz number so I am not quite sure how it will match up, but it does say that it can take up to eight weeks for your status to be reflected in your Hertz Gold Plus Rewards account.

Really this promotion is better for those with Diamond and Platinum status as you’ll receive President’s Circle status. With this status you’ll receive a guaranteed one-class upgrade and a 25% bonus on all Hertz points earned. If you have Gold status and will receive the Hertz Five Star status through this promotion it will give you a one-class upgrade if available, so no guarantees. You’ll also get a 10% bonus on all Hertz points earned. You can learn more about the various benefits with Hertz status here.
